HAM RADIO: How to connect a N-Type Coax Connector. I have been asked by many of you how to connect a N-Type connector, so in this upload I show you how I put one on the end of a length of RG213.
These connectors are mainly used on equipment using frequencies over 300 MHz so 70cm and 23cm Bands.....and others!
